Middle Atlantic QTFP-2 3U Rack Fan Panel, 100 CFM

Overview

The Middle Atlantic QTFP-2 is a 3U active rack fan panel designed to exhaust heat from enclosed rack bays housing AV, security, and networking equipment. Running on 120 VAC and moving 100 CFM, it fits the common scenario where a rack enclosure full of NVRs, switches, or amplifiers is trapping heat and throttling hardware. At 2 inches deep, the QTFP-2 installs into any open 3U slot without consuming disproportionate rack space. The textured black powder coat finish matches standard Middle Atlantic rack furniture. Mounts via 2 mounting points into a standard 19-inch rack rail — no custom hardware required.

Compatibility

Fits any standard EIA 19-inch, 3U rack opening. Directly compatible with Middle Atlantic rack enclosures including the BGR, ERK, and WMRK series, as well as any third-party rack conforming to EIA-310 19-inch rail spacing. Pairs naturally with equipment that generates sustained heat loads: NVRs, PoE switches, video decoders, and amplifiers. Intended for indoor AC-powered installations only — 120 VAC power required; not rated for international voltage. Not suitable for DC-powered enclosures or outdoor deployments. For broader thermal management planning in rack builds, verify total BTU load before specifying a single panel versus a multi-fan configuration.

Installation Notes

Requires a standard 120 VAC outlet or switched outlet strip inside or adjacent to the rack. The unit is 2 inches deep — confirm rear clearance in shallow-depth enclosures before ordering. Two mounting points secure the panel to standard rack rails; no special tooling required beyond a standard screwdriver.
